Q1: Why is density important in this conversion?
A: Density connects volume and mass. Different substances have different densities, so the same volume of different materials will have different masses.
Q2: How do I find the density of a substance?
A: Density can be found in reference tables, material safety data sheets, or measured experimentally by dividing mass by volume.
Q3: Can I use this for any substance?
A: Yes, as long as you know the correct density at the given temperature and pressure conditions.
Q4: What are common density values?
A: Water has density of 1000 mg/mL, while oils range 800-950 mg/mL, and metals have much higher densities.
Q5: Is temperature important for density?
A: Yes, density changes with temperature. Use density values measured at the same temperature as your application for accurate results.
